I took on my kitchen and living room for a remodel this yr. I think my upstairs and bathroom will be happening next yr, plus with all the freebies I've picked up looking to do a budget sauna possibly in spring. In the mean time enjoying my new wood stove on a cool night. Moved the window over the kitchen sink over 3', removed a large picture window and replaced it with a.sliding patio door, removed a entry door on the north side of the house and cut in a new window in centered on the wall. Just finished siding repairs this past weekend and added supports for my deck extension for next yr.

Finally got to work on my car, brought the head in and had new guides, valves, and 8 seats done. Fired it up tonight, fun to start it and not see copious amounts of smoke from the tail pipe. Can't wait to drive it!! 2-4 yrs of the car being down actually should be good now. I
